Applies the quality management system requirements with a focus on supplier quality, resolving quality issues, and ensuring quality standards are met. Develops, modifies, applies, and maintains quality standards for products and processes. Provides statistical information for quality improvement by gathering data on trends and root cause analyses. Responsible for guiding technical evaluations, analyses, and related data acquisition processes to support quality initiatives throughout the organization and lead improvement efforts across multiple disciplines. Improvement Efforts - Evaluates quality processes and develops improvement efforts through data analysis, management of documentation, and policies, procedures, and records. - Evaluates effectiveness of quality programs (such as production, inspection, testing, design review, and procedures) with quality requirements. - Develops and implements methods and procedures for inspecting, testing and evaluating the precision, reliability and accuracy of products and processes. - Validates process, procedure, and product changes by examining impacts on quality and communicating required actions to internal and external stakeholders - Assesses quality performance (or cost-of-quality) using statistical and analytical methods. - Provides input on quality to product development teams. - Prepares reports by collecting, interpreting, analyzing and summarizing data. - Leads failure analysis and corrective action investigations with cross functional teams - Refines and enhances products and processes by applying continuous improvement - Participation in certification audits as needed. Supplier Quality - Assesses the quality of supplier's capabilities and metrics. - Develops and initiates programs to improve supplier performance. - Communicates with suppliers regarding quality issues, process improvements, and specification requirements. - Executes improvement initiatives for managing quality standards of component parts, which may include making vendor visits as needed. - Collaborating with suppliers to ensure component part specifications are met. - Collaborates with production and engineering team members to align component quality with product quality standards and customer needs. - Participation in supplier audits as needed. Customer Quality - Assesses the cost of, and responsibility for, products or materials that do not meet required standards and specifications by performing statistical analyses. - Identifies quality performance, trends and corrective action by coordinating with customers and suppliers. - Communicates with customers regarding quality issues, process improvements, and product capabilities and features. - Communicates quality solutions with customers by validating product improvement actions and performance characteristics. - Resolve quality issues and assist the broader team to fully address customer feedback in a timely manner. - Bachelor's Degree (BS) in Engineering required preferably in Mechanical, Industrial, Electrical or Chemical engineering fields - Ability to effectively assess and implement continuous improvement techniques to quality and manufacturing functions. - Six Sigma and Lean tools experience is required, Green or Black Belt Six Sigma certification is a plus - Familiarity with industry standards requirements, such as ISO 13485, ISO 9001, IATF 16949 for quality and ISO 14971 for risk management is highly desired - American Society for Quality certification desired. - Effective communicator with team members and management. - Strong problem-solving skills with data-driven decision making. - Project management experience is desired.
